Victor-JVC unveiled new in-ear earphones dedicated for the sport, the HA-EBX85. Stylish, this new earphones provides nice specs with a frequency response of 10Hz - 23,000 Hz, a sound pressure level of 102dB/mW, driver of 11mm, Neodymium magnet, and an impedance of 16 Ohms.

The DZ-110S, are ArtDios latest PC speakers featuring a 50mm driver unit and offering an acceptable 3Wx2ch output with a reproduction bandwidth of 120Hz to 20kHz
Nothing really impressive but for 4380 yen these nicely design speaker may be a good bargain.

Transcend's MP330 is a versatile digital music player with support for newer file formats such as FLAC (Free Lossless Audio Codec) as well as MP3, WMA, WAV, and even WMA-DRM10 protected music files.

Yamaha released a new micro HiFi, the MCR-140, with a USB port, CD player and 2x15W speakers. It features an iPod AirWired cradle for wirelessly streaming iPod audio (lossless) to a hi-fi (up to 10m).
